Did some current and voltage drop measurements on a selenium rectifier that I had laying around, and did some curve fitting to create a 3f4 Spice model. the diode was marked "RCA 752652" and has 6 fins.
* seleniumdiode CircuitMaker model
.SUBCKT Xrca752652 P K
Bp P K I=(12.42276354/1.0e4)*uramp((V(P,K)*0.55)+(-2.938702085))^2.4
.ends Xrca752652
